java

Java SE at a Glance

Java Platform, Standard Edition (Java SE) empowers you to develop and deploy robust, secure applications across desktops, servers, cloud environments, and virtually any connected device. With unmatched versatility, performance, portability, and a rich user experience, Java SE is the foundation for today’s most demanding and innovative applications, including AI-powered solutions, anywhere your business needs to run. Seamlessly integrate advanced analytics and AI capabilities with Java’s proven enterprise reliability and drive your next generation of intelligent applications with confidence.

  • Java Platform, Standard Edition 8

    Java SE 8u481 is the latest release of Java SE 8 Platform. Oracle strongly recommends that all Java SE 8 users upgrade to this release.

    JDK for ARM releases are available on the same page as the downloads for other platforms

  • Download
  • Release Notes
  • JDK Mission Control

    JDK Mission Control (JMC) is an advanced set of tools for managing, monitoring, profiling, and troubleshooting Java applications. JMC enables efficient and detailed data analysis for areas such as code performance, memory, and latency without introducing the performance overhead normally associated with profiling and monitoring tools.

  • Java Management Service

    Discover, secure, and optimize your enterprise Java—on desktops, servers, OCI, and other clouds—from a single, unified console. See which Java versions (Oracle and non-Oracle) are installed and in use, track vulnerabilities, and automate updates to keep environments current and compliant.

  • Java SE Subscription Enterprise Performance Pack (EPP)

    Drop-in runtime upgrade that brings JDK 17-level performance to JDK 8 applications—no code changes required. Customers typically see faster response times, lower CPU and memory usage, and improved scalability on existing infrastructure.

  • Java Verified Portfolio

    The Java Verified Portfolio offers a curated collection of Oracle-backed Java tools, libraries, and services — each validated for enterprise use and supported with clear roadmaps and compatibility guarantees — empowering organizations to innovate confidently and streamline Java application development and management.

  • JavaFX

    Delivers a powerful platform for building modern, visually rich desktop applications in Java—enabling businesses to create interactive data and AI visualizations, advanced user interfaces, and seamless cross-platform experiences, all backed by commercial support for long-term reliability and innovation.


Products and Training

Oracle Java SE Subscriptions

Expert monitoring, diagnostics, and centralized management for enterprise and ISV Java-based applications.

Oracle Java SE Training and Certification

Java SE Learning Subscriptions

Java SE Learning Subscriptions will help you get up to speed quickly on how to program in Java, apply what you have learned to building applications, and use Java in business environments.

Java SE Certifications

Nearly one million people are Oracle Certified, establishing themselves as experts in Java technology. Review exam topics to see what it takes to get your certification credential. Invest in your certification and become a recognized Java SE Developer.

Learn More about Java Software

Java can reduce costs, drive innovation, and improve application services.


Ecosystem

Dev.java
The destination for Java developers with hundreds of tutorials, news and videos from the experts.

Ops.java

Become a part of the OpenJDK Community
Help shape the future of Java by joining and becoming an OpenJDK Contributor.

Stay socially connected with OpenJDK
Follow OpenJDK on X for social updates.

Remain informed on Java Platform news
Read about news and updates published by members of the Oracle Java Platform Team.